Hiya

I am taking 14 weeks paid parental leave soon and then not going back to work after (as my contract ends after PPL). I will probably have 8 ish weeks left on PPL once bubs is born, will I qualify for anything from WFF? How does it work?

Thanks in advance

The cut off is around 70k for 1 child and it doesn't take into account what you have earn't in the year before having the child - ppl is $458.82 as per http://www.ird.govt.nz/yoursituation-ind/parents/parents-paid-parental-leave.html so that plus any wfftc entitlement which could be $148ish would be more then the dpb? call ird hun they will let you know what you can do.
